SpaceX set to complete the first Starlink launch of 2021

SpaceX wants to envelope Earth with up to 42,000 satellites.

SpaceX’s first Starlink launch of 2021 has been delayed to January 20 at 8:02EST from Launch Complex 39A at the Kennedy Space Center in Florida.

The Falcon 9 rocket, holding 60 Starlink satellites, was scheduled for blast-off on Monday at 8:45 a.m. EST, but unfavourable weather conditions in the recovery area prevented the launch.
